iv) CS, LA, MMcE, MMcL: Walk from Aultbea to the Fionn Loch

An 18 km circuit along clear track over undulating moorland. Lots of birds and wildlife, as well as stunning views of Beinn Chaisgein Mor, Beinn Lair, and Beinn Airgh Charr from the Loch.

i) ARob and MMcE: Beinn Dearg Mòr and Beinn Dearg Bheag (Corbetts)

After cycling in to Loch na Sealga, walked along the shore to corrie outflow, then up into corrie and up onto saddle. Views from corrie, but no views at summits. A fairly challenging day over rough ground.

iii) LA and CS: Beinn Airigh Charr (Corbett)

Navigation required some work, as the mists gathered during our ascent. Enjoyable walk through varied terrain, woodland, heathery slopes, a short section through a gorge, cliffs, and scree nearer the top.
